Property Details for 15 Kensington Way, Strathpine

15 Kensington Way, Strathpine is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1965. The property has a land size of 637m2 and floor size of 86m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2022.

About Strathpine 4500

The size of Strathpine is approximately 7.2 square kilometres. It has 27 parks covering nearly 17.8% of total area. The population of Strathpine in 2011 was 9,276 people. By 2016 the population was 9,512 showing a population growth of 2.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Strathpine is 30-39 years. Households in Strathpine are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Strathpine work in a clerical occupation. In 2011, 73.1% of the homes in Strathpine were owner-occupied compared with 71.5% in 2016.

Strathpine has 4,874 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Strathpine have seen a 79.91%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 92.30%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Strathpine is $739,423 while the median value for Units is $533,509.
  • Houses have a median rent of $590 while Units have a median rent of $475.
There are currently 30 properties listed for sale, and 23 properties listed for rent in Strathpine on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 189 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Strathpine.
